Audrey Evelyn Mayfield

of Little Rock, AR

December 8, 1935 - April 19, 2018

Audrey Evelyn Mayfield, 82, of Little Rock, AR., passed away April 19, 2018. She was born December 8, 1935, in Calion, AR. to Jerrell Parker and Louis Butcher. She spent her life as a homemaker and mother. She is preceded in death by her husband, Lloyd Nevil Mayfield; her parents; a daughter, Dianne Sizemore; two brothers: Billy Joe Parker and Sherald Parker.

She is survived by a son, Lloyd Steven Mayfield (Beverly) of Bryant; two grandchildren: Shawn Mayfield and Shanan Crowder (Todd); four great grandchildren: Kylie Mayfield, Brayden Mayfield, Alec Crowder and Carson, Crowder; one brother, Doug Parker (Joyce) of El Dorado, AR.

Funeral service will be held 2:00 P.M., Monday, April 23, 2018 at Roller-Drummond Funeral Home Chapel, 10900 Interstate 30, Little Rock, AR., 72209, with Dr. Margaret Pace officiating. Burial will follow the service at Martin Cemetery. Visitation will be Sunday, April 22, at the funeral home from 4:00-6:00 P.M. Online guestbook: www.rollerfuneralhomes.com/drummond
